The Visual Personality of Yupo
At first glance, Yupo appears to be a spirited script font with strong influences from a handwritten font style. However, its construction reveals a deeper level of typographic sophistication. The strokes vary in thickness, mimicking the natural flow of a brush or marker, which adds a tactile quality often missing in digital modern typography. Unlike rigid geometric sans serif fonts or overly formal serif fonts, Yupo feels organic and alive.
The character set features rounded terminals and dynamic swashes that suggest movement. This "effervescent" quality is achieved through subtle irregularities in the baseline and letter spacing, preventing the text from looking mechanical. When used in logo design, these characteristics create a brand identity that feels approachable and friendly. For instance, a bakery using Yupo for its logo immediately signals homemade quality and warmth, whereas a tech startup might use it sparingly on holiday cards to show a more human side of the company culture.
Visually, Yupo bridges the gap between a decorative display font and a legible text face. While it shines in headlines, its clarity allows it to hold its own in short paragraphs, provided the size is appropriate. This versatility is rare among festive fonts, which often sacrifice readability for ornamentation. Yupo manages to maintain high engagement levels because the eye can easily track the words while enjoying the aesthetic flair.

Impact on Brand Perception and Readability
Choosing a font like Yupo is a strategic decision that impacts how your brand is perceived. Typography plays a crucial role in establishing visual hierarchy and guiding the reader's eye. Yupo naturally draws attention, making it ideal for calls to action or key messages that need to stand out. However, its influence extends beyond mere visibility; it shapes the emotional tone of the communication.
When used correctly, Yupo enhances brand identity by signaling values such as joy, inclusivity, and creativity. It tells the audience that the brand understands the importance of celebration and human connection. Conversely, overusing it can dilute its impact. To maintain professionalism, it is best reserved for specific moments—headlines, logos, or accent text—rather than body copy. This selective usage ensures that the font retains its special status and does not become background noise.
Readability remains a critical factor. While Yupo is designed for display purposes, its open counters and clear letterforms ensure that it remains legible at moderate sizes. Designers should avoid shrinking it below 14 points for web use or 10 points for print, as the intricate details may blur. Testing the font in different contexts is essential to ensure it supports the content rather than distracting from it. A well-executed font pairing strategy can further enhance readability, allowing Yupo to shine as the star while a neutral sans serif handles the detailed information.
Practical Guidance for Implementation
Integrating Yupo into your workflow requires careful consideration of project fit and licensing. Before committing, evaluate whether the festive nature of the font aligns with your current goals. If your project demands strict corporate minimalism, Yupo might feel out of place. However, for campaigns centered around community, family, or seasonal promotions, it is an ideal choice.
Start by reviewing the included styles. Most commercial font packages offer multiple weights or alternates that add variety to your designs. Experiment with these variations to see which ones best suit your layout. Pairing Yupo with a clean, geometric sans serif font creates a balanced contrast that highlights the personality of the script while maintaining structure. Avoid pairing it with other highly decorative fonts, as this can lead to visual clutter.
Licensing is another vital aspect. As a premium font, Yupo comes with specific terms regarding commercial use. Ensure you have the appropriate license for your intended application, whether it is for web embedding, app development, or large-scale print runs. Using a font without the correct license can lead to legal complications and damage your professional reputation. Always verify the scope of the license before finalizing any design assets.
Finally, test your designs across different devices and materials. What looks vibrant on a screen might appear flat in print if the ink coverage isn't adjusted. Print proofs are essential to check how the fine lines and curves of Yupo reproduce on paper.
